Massachusetts Court Holds Statute of Repose Does Not Apply to Claims for Failure to Maintain Property
In Penn-America Insurance Company v. Bay State Gas Company, 96 Mass. App. Ct. 757 (2019), the Appeals Court of Massachusetts considered whether the plaintiff’s claims against the defendant, arising from an alleged defect in the defendant’s natural...
